My Buying Guides on Best Leave In Conditioner For Gray Hair
When I shop for the best leave-in conditioner for gray hair, I focus on formulas that keep my strands soft, hydrated, and bright without weighing them down. Gray hair can feel drier, coarser, or more wiry than pigmented hair, so the right leave-in conditioner makes a big difference in how manageable and healthy it looks.
1. Why I Need a Leave-In Conditioner for Gray Hair
I’ve found that gray hair often needs extra moisture because it tends to lose some of its natural oils over time. A good leave-in conditioner helps me reduce frizz, improve softness, and make my hair easier to detangle. It also helps protect my hair from everyday dryness caused by heat styling, weather, and washing.
2. Ingredients I Look For
When I read the label, I look for ingredients that nourish and smooth my gray hair. Some of the best ones for me include:
- Argan oil
- Shea butter
- Coconut oil
- Glycerin
- Aloe vera
- Keratin
- Panthenol
- Jojoba oil
These ingredients help my hair stay moisturized, shiny, and more flexible.
3. Ingredients I Try to Avoid
I usually avoid products with harsh ingredients that can make gray hair look dull or feel dry. For my hair, I try to stay away from:
- Heavy silicones that build up
- Drying alcohols
- Sulfates
- Too much fragrance if my scalp is sensitive
Since gray hair can be more delicate, I prefer a gentle formula that supports softness without residue.
4. Lightweight vs. Rich Formulas
I choose the formula based on how my hair feels.
- If my gray hair is fine, I go for a lightweight leave-in conditioner so it won’t look greasy or flat.
- If my hair is thick, coarse, or very dry, I prefer a richer cream or lotion that gives deeper moisture.
Finding the right texture helps me keep my hair soft without making it limp.
5. Purple Toning Benefits
If my gray hair tends to look yellow or brassy, I like a leave-in conditioner that has a slight purple toning effect. It helps brighten my silver strands and keeps them looking fresh. I make sure not to overuse toning products, though, because too much can leave a tint.
6. Heat and UV Protection
I always look for a leave-in conditioner that offers heat protection if I use blow dryers, flat irons, or curling tools. UV protection is also a plus because sunlight can make gray hair look dull or dry. Extra protection helps me maintain shine and strength.
7. How I Match the Product to My Hair Type
I get the best results when I choose a leave-in conditioner that fits my hair type:
- Fine gray hair: lightweight spray or mist
- Wavy gray hair: smoothing lotion with frizz control
- Curly gray hair: richer cream for moisture and definition
- Coarse gray hair: deeply hydrating leave-in with oils and butters
Matching the product to my hair texture helps me avoid buildup and get better results.
8. How I Use Leave-In Conditioner for Best Results
I usually apply leave-in conditioner to damp hair after washing. I focus on the mid-lengths and ends first, then use whatever is left on my hands near the top. I don’t overapply because gray hair can get weighed down quickly. A small amount often goes a long way.
